In a fiery moment at the United Nations, President Trump recounted how he once offered to rebuild the entire UN complex for $500 million, promising marble floors, mahogany walls, and top-tier craftsmanship. Instead, global officials chose a different plan that ballooned to $2–4 billion, plagued by massive cost overruns and lacking the luxury finishes he proposed. With his signature confidence, Trump declared, “I was right,” drawing laughs and applause as he highlighted the waste and mismanagement he’s long criticized on the world stage.
